| feature |
Data collection speed: 10ms/point
Magnetic field control rate: 8604:10000 Oe/s; 8607: 5000 Oe/s
• Automatic rotation
Multiple temperature options are available, with a maximum temperature of 1273K
The maximum magnetic field is greater than 3T
• Quickly test the first-order reversal curve function
Water cooled electromagnet can provide excellent magnetic field stability, with a maximum long-term stable magnetic field
Bipolar four quadrant electromagnet power supply smoothly crosses zero
| Testable material |
Various magnetic materials, including:
•Antimagnetic materials, paramagnetic materials, ferrite magnetic materials, ferromagnesian magnetic materials, antiferromagnetic materials, anisotropic materials
•Particle and continuous medium magnetic recording materials, layer GMR, CMR, partial exchange interaction, and spin electron materials
•Magneto optical materials
•Bulk magnetic materials, powders, films, single crystals, magnetic liquids
| measurement |
The following parameters can be directly measured or calculated by the system software:
•Hysteresis loop: M vs H curve, saturation magnetization (MSAT), remanence (MREM), coercivity (Hc), coercivity tilt angle, dM/dHValue, or relative sensitivity of coercivity, distribution of conversion zone, flatness, rectangular ratio, hysteresis loss, Ws, minimum hysteresis curve
•Initial magnetization curve
•DC remanence
•Communicating residual magnetism
•Time function of magnetization data
•First order reversal curves (FORCs)
| System Options |
•Integrated high and low temperature options: 100K to 950K
High temperature option: Room temperature to 1273K
Low temperature options: 10K to 450K@LHe , 100k-450k@LN2
Vector coil: capable of simultaneously measuring vector values in both X and Y directions of the sample
